Transaction ab2e108f43b4758595df10efade5b4eeacbd6682884d7190024f832e79a4fbba

85 Input
1 Outputs
  • ab2e108f43b4758595df10efade5b4eeacbd6682884d7190024f832e79a4fbba:0
  • value  10703580
    address  37fYG8qTNtP5n4ry8itp38n6vLfDEACGAG